The Gateway: Breath and Meditation
So, how do we ensure that our prayers are sincere, deeply connected, and capable of creating miracles in our lives? The answer lies in finding a meditative state before we embark on the journey of prayer. Meditation becomes the sacred space where we cleanse our canvas, removing the barriers that hinder our connection.
Let me share a simple yet potent technique to achieve this meditative state:
Begin by taking a deep, deliberate breath through your nose, allowing the inhalation to last for four serene seconds.
As you exhale, release all tensions, all worries, for a tranquil sixteen seconds.
Dedicate just five minutes to this practice, allowing your breath to wash away the clutter of the mind.
In these moments, you will find yourself entering the gateway to meditation, to that peaceful abode where your soul can truly flourish.
